How much do bodyguards cost in South Africa?

How much do bodyguards cost in South Africa?

The average pay for a Bodyguard is ZAR 120,339 a year and ZAR 58 an hour in South Africa. The average salary range for a Bodyguard is between ZAR 93,596 and ZAR 143,975.

How many security agencies are there in South Africa?

The private security industry in South Africa is among the largest in the world, with over 9,000 registered companies, 450,000 registered active private security guards and a further 1.5 million qualified (but inactive) guards; many times more than the available personnel of the combined South African police and army.

Do bodyguards make good money?

It’s a big industry and growing. The average bodyguard makes $55,000 per year while some sign contracts for $700 per day or $180,000 per year. Location, experience, training, job description, and danger are the major factors in determining pay. Being a bodyguard can be mundane or it can be deadly.

How much is a bodyguard cost?

The national average cost for bodyguard protection is $20 to 30 per hour. However, a bodyguard can cost anywhere from $75 per hour for one guard at a one-day private event to $150 per hour for executive protection that may require bodyguards on-site 24/7.

How many bodyguards does a South African Minister have?

Two bodyguards are assigned to each South African minister, one of whom doubles as a chauffeur, and they are under instructions not to sleep while their minister is awake.
